Quick Summary
When using the Moonshot AI model kimi-k2.5 (a reasoning model) via the picoclaw-gateway, the API returns a 400 Bad Request error during multi-turn conversations or tool calls.
Error Log
Plaintext Error processing message: LLM call failed after retries: API request failed: Status: 400 Body: {"error":{"message":"thinking is enabled but reasoning_content is missing in assistant tool call message at index 4","type":"invalid_request_error"}}
Environment
Model: moonshot/kimi-k2.5
PicoClaw Version: Latest (main branch)